Buying a health insurance policy is only the first step. Understanding what it covers and how to use it effectively is equally important. Many people are unaware of:
Sum Insured: This is the maximum amount your insurance will pay in a year. For example, if your policy covers ₹5 lakh and you spend ₹3 lakh during a surgery, ₹2 lakh remains for future treatment in the same year.
Cashless vs. Reimbursement Claims: In a cashless setup, the insurer directly pays the hospital. In reimbursement, you pay the hospital first, then submit bills to the insurance company to get your money back—a more tedious and time-consuming process.
Room Rent Limits: Many policies cap the daily cost they’ll cover for hospital rooms. Exceeding this may lead to additional personal expenses.

Your policy might also have sub-limits for tests, doctor fees, or consumables. Reading the policy document—or at least the summary—helps avoid financial shocks during discharge.
Cashless claims are only possible at network hospitals—these are hospitals that have tie-ups with insurance providers. Not all hospitals offer this, and not all are empanelled under every policy.
